Output c6a94b526fe4ce3b5a714c1e346bfb92ffa7b15e791f86b150802960d8e39def:11

value
51832584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a459717f1d08e50542933d2ca0e917c3578f26 OP_EQUAL
address
MPusNCLDzcozTKCuCFiAQWZREatiE8MtT3
transaction
c6a94b526fe4ce3b5a714c1e346bfb92ffa7b15e791f86b150802960d8e39def
spent
true